Unveiling Your Aim: Exploring Riflescope Reticles

When it comes to precision shooting, a riflescope's reticle plays a vital role. This array of delicate lines etched onto the lens not only helps you center your target but also provides valuable data about range and windage. From simple crosshairs to complex ballistic reticles, understanding the nuances of each type can significantly improve your accuracy and skill.

Modern Rifle Scopes: Features Exceeding the Basics

Stepping beyond the basic reticle of a rifle scope unveils a world of advanced features designed to optimize your shooting performance. Modern scopes often feature backlighting, allowing for precise aim in low-conditions. Dialable magnification provides the flexibility to adjust your field of view based on the proximity to your target. Some scopes even utilize ballistic adjustments, correcting bullet drop and windage for greater accuracy at long range. These sophisticated features transform the scope from a simple sight to a powerful tool for any serious shooter.

Selecting a Durable and Reliable Rifle Scope

Investing in a rifle scope is a significant decision for any marksman. While price can be a factor, prioritizing on durability and reliability will ultimately provide a more rewarding experience. A high-quality scope should withstand the rigors of outdoor use, from harsh weather conditions to repeated recoil. Assess the materials used in construction, such as hardened glass lenses and sturdy steel housings. Look for proven brands known for their commitment to quality and customer satisfaction. A durable scope will not only last but also enhance your accuracy and overall enjoyment of target practice or hunting excursions.
